I am a composer and conductor with over 25 years of public performance experience as player, singer, composer and conductor. I have a degree in Composition and Film-Scoring from Berklee College of Music in Boston, MA and I have done graduate work in composition and conducting at New England Conservatory and Boston University.

I have appeared as a conductor with the Brookline Symphony Orchestra, the Paul Madore Chorale, the Berklee Concert Wind Ensemble and the Brookline Symphony Chamber Orchestra. I have served as Assistant Conductor of the Brookline Symphony Orchestra since 1994. I regularly appear with the Paul Madore Chorale in Salem as a guest conductor performing such works as the Verdi, Mozart and Faure requeims, and, most recently, Carl Orff's Carmina Burana.

I am currently in pre-production for a CD of my music to be released in the near future.
